Ver Fonte

qcacmn: Smart Mesh Unlock mutex after NAC filtering

Mutex needs to be unlocked in NAC filtering success path, before
sending packet to stack.

Change-Id: I7bf2e84ee5889b78a956a7c757bb22231c45022e
CRs-Fixed: 2017269
Pratik Gandhi há 7 anos atrás
pai
commit
97fa0b0162
1 ficheiros alterados com 3 adições e 0 exclusões
  1. 3 0
      dp/wifi3.0/dp_rx.c

+ 3 - 0
dp/wifi3.0/dp_rx.c

@@ -569,6 +569,9 @@ struct dp_vdev *dp_rx_nac_filter(struct dp_pdev *pdev,
 				peer->neighbour_peers_macaddr.raw[3],
 				peer->neighbour_peers_macaddr.raw[4],
 				peer->neighbour_peers_macaddr.raw[5]);
+
+				qdf_spin_unlock_bh(&pdev->neighbour_peer_mutex);
+
 			return pdev->monitor_vdev;
 		}
 	}